diff options
-rw-r--r-- | libsqlitepp/sqlite-modifycommand.cpp | 2 | ||||
-rw-r--r-- | libsqlitepp/unittests/testsqlite.cpp | 1 |
2 files changed, 2 insertions, 1 deletions
diff --git a/libsqlitepp/sqlite-modifycommand.cpp b/libsqlitepp/sqlite-modifycommand.cpp index df859ca..d69516d 100644 --- a/libsqlitepp/sqlite-modifycommand.cpp +++ b/libsqlitepp/sqlite-modifycommand.cpp @@ -15,7 +15,7 @@ SQLite::ModifyCommand::execute(bool anc) sqlite3_reset(stmt); throw Error(c->db); } - unsigned int rows = static_cast<unsigned int>(sqlite3_changes(c->db)); + auto rows = static_cast<unsigned int>(sqlite3_changes(c->db)); sqlite3_reset(stmt); if (rows == 0 && !anc) { throw DB::NoRowsAffected(); diff --git a/libsqlitepp/unittests/testsqlite.cpp b/libsqlitepp/unittests/testsqlite.cpp index 37f17ce..5a14bfb 100644 --- a/libsqlitepp/unittests/testsqlite.cpp +++ b/libsqlitepp/unittests/testsqlite.cpp @@ -43,6 +43,7 @@ BOOST_AUTO_TEST_CASE(bindAndSend) mod->bindParamF(1, testDouble); mod->bindParamS(2, testString); mod->execute(); + // cppcheck-suppress assertWithSideEffect BOOST_REQUIRE_EQUAL(2, rw->insertId()); } |